1999 Chevrolet Monte Carlo LS, 3.8 KSECTION Fluids
| FLUID CAPACITIES | |||||||
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Fluid Type | Application | Standard | Metric | Fluid Spec | Note | S/H | |
| Air Cond Compressor Oil | 9.00 OZS. | 0.26 L | PAG 150 | S | |||
| Air Cond Refrigerant | 2.25 LBS. | 1.02 KG | R-134a | Refer to TSB No. 99 01 38 005. | S | ||
| Brake Fluid | N/A | N/A | DOT 3 Brake Fluid | S | |||
| Engine Coolant | 3.8L Eng | 11.70 QTS. | 11.07 L | 50/50 mixture of DEX-COOL and clean, drinkable water | S | ||
| Engine Oil | 3.8L Eng | 4.50 QTS. | 4.25 L | API - SAE 10W-30 | S | ||
| Fuel Tank | 16.60 GALS. | 62.83 L | S | ||||

When to See a Mechanic
Stop DIY work and contact a certified mechanic immediately if any of the following apply:
- β’ You smell fuel, burning insulation, or see smoke.
- β’ Brakes feel soft, pull hard to one side, or make grinding noises.
- β’ The engine overheats, stalls repeatedly, or misfires under load.
- β’ You are missing required tools, torque specs, or safe lifting equipment.
- β’ You are not confident in the next step or safety outcome.
